Duke of Edinburgh – Gold 2025

West Wales District Sea Cadets recently supported a Gold Duke of Edinburgh Award Scheme Expedition to Snowdonia for our cadets to qualify in their expedition section.

Through this expedition, they were supported by 4 adult volunteers, providing remote supervision and assessment throughout this time.  Remote being the key word, as the participants need to be self sufficient from planning their route, map reading, carrying all they require, cooking and sleeping in a tent for 4 days and 3 nights.  Carrying all they require includes all clothing, as well as expedition based equipment such as stove, food, tent, waterproofs, map and compass.

Through this time every participant takes the lead on map reading to lead the way but it pulls them together as a team, working with each other, supporting each other and develop resilience throughout.  It really does teach you new skills, including perseverance and determination.
